2758861
0xa6bc335641101cb765b43e17dd8766de47b924ce97aa2fe27e29265368633e1d
Transactions0
Height2758861
Confirmations13421563
Timestamp1127 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x7cd07068f79c9045
Bits
Difficulty0xcf21a17